Abstract
|
[Objective] To evaluate the effect of thistle flavescens on collagen-induced arthritis(CIA) in mice by regulating STING/NF-κB signaling pathway. [Methods] Forty SPF grade female C57BL/6 mice were divided into blank control group(Sham), model group(CIA), methotrexate group(MTX, 1 mg/kg) and cirsimaritin group(JHS, 100 mg/kg). The mice rheumatoid arthritis models were established by collagen immunoassay. After 4 weeks of drug intervention, the experiment was completed. Swelling degree of the hind PAWS, levels of TNF-α, IL-1β, IL-6, IL-10, MDA and SOD activity in serum were detected, morphological changes of the left knee joint were observed, and the expression level of STING/NF-κB pathway key proteins in the right knee joint was measured. [Results] Compared with CIA group, the swelling degree of hind PAWS in MTX group and JHS group was significantly decreased(P<0.01), the levels of TNF-α, IL-1β, IL-6, IL-10 and MDA in serum were significantly decreased, while the activity of SOD was significantly increased(P<0.01), the inflammatory cell infiltration of knee joint was significantly decreased, and the cartilage tissue damage was significantly alleviated. The expression levels of STING and P-NF-κB p65/NF-κB protein in knee joint were significantly decreased(P<0.01). [Conclusion] Cirsimaritin can significantly improve rheumatoid arthritis, and its mechanism may be related to reducing inflammation and oxidative stress damage by regulating STING/NF-κB signaling pathway. |
